CLINICAL AND PARACLINICAL FEATURES OF HEPATITIS B AND C FLOW IN EARLY-AGED CHILDREN WITH PERINATAL INFECTION

Children from mothers who were in risk group have perinatal infection by the hepatitis B and C viruses more frequently: HBV - 37,5%, HCV- 30,8%, the majority (42,8%) at coinfection of HCV and HIV. Elimination of maternal antibodies at coinfection is marked during more prolonged terms.
